DRILLING-HOW MUCH WILL IT COST?

LBSR is sitting on top of the hottest mineral market in history with the Big Chunk Super Project and Bonanza Hills project. In fact, some are asking how much it will cost for a preliminary drill project to get things going.

You must remember that the purpose of a JV is for drilling. Mr. Briscoe called for drilling money through a partnership within NR-93

The Company continues aggressively to seek joint venture partner(s) to drill these geophysically defined porphyry anomalies

And as ten million dollars is being allocated, perhaps drilling can begin speedily, even with a six-year time limit; a protection clause, in my opinion.

Northern Dynasty can earn a 60% interest in the Company’s Big Chunk and Bonanza Hills projects in Alaska by spending $10,000,000 on those properties over six years

True, we have not heard any finalized report, however, I think it is safe to say that drilling money has been allocated for the same reason that the 23.4 square miles sold has already been recorded.

In order to pay out its former lenders, the Company has sold 60.7 square kilometers (23.4 square miles out of the Company’s original 177 square miles, or 13% of its Big Chunk and Bonanza Hills acreage) in consideration for both $1,000,000 cash payment and a convertible loan from Northern Dynasty Minerals Ltd

Now, 10 million dollars is plenty of money because less than 10 million dollars was spent in 2003 in NAK's intitial drill project at Pebble:

The main exploration expenditure was for drilling (2003 - $2,700,068; 2002 - $1,142,867). During the 2003 fiscal year, 21,713 metres (71,238 feet) of drilling were completed

Wild cat holes for an intitial drill program and strategy by NAK at Pebble in 2003 may certainly explain the strategy with the Big Chunk Super Project, as well:

Dickinson, an economic geologist with more than 40 years of mining experience, kept looking. The first thing we did was drill wildcat holes along the belt. The results from that program said there would be more to come, he explains. The first breakthrough came in late 2003-2004 when extensive drilling revealed significantly higher levels of potential resources

Mind you, NAK's drilling project at Pebble came at a time before ZTEM surveys were known. However, the drilling of 2003 was still enough to find 1.5 billion dollars through Anglo-American.
